Advertisement
Guest User

Untitled

a guest
Jan 17th, 2019
97
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
SAS 0.58 KB | None | 0 0
  1. data wykres.vin;
  2. set wej.Transactions;
  3. seniority=intck('month',input(fin_period,yymmn6.),input(period,yymmn6.));
  4. vin1=(due_installments>=1);
  5. vin2=(due_installments>=2);
  6. vin3=(due_installments>=3);
  7. output;
  8. if status in ('B','C') and period<='200812' then do;
  9.     n_steps=intck('month',input(period,yymmn6.),input('200812',yymmn6.));
  10.     do i=1 to n_steps;
  11.         period=put(intnx('month',input(period,yymmn6.),1,'end'),yymmn6.);
  12.         seniority=intck('month',input(fin_period,yymmn6.),input(period,yymmn6.));
  13.         output;
  14.     end;
  15. end;
  16. keep fin_period vin3 vin2 vin1 seniority aid cid product;
  17. run;
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ement